Around Mustang Ridge ...

The largest community within a 50 mile [80 km] radius is Austin. It is located about 15 miles [24 km] to the north of Mustang Ridge. Austin has a population of 995,000 people.<1>.

The next largest community is Pflugerville. It is located about 28 miles [ km] to the north of Mustang Ridge and has a population of 66,800 people.

For comparison, Mustang Ridge has a population of 1,000 people.

Bastrop County ...

Mustang Ridge is primarily located in Bastrop County<4>. A portion of Mustang Ridge extends into Caldwell County and Travis County.

The following counties adjoin and form the boundaries of Bastrop County: Caldwell, Fayette, Gonzales, Lee & Travis.
